Job Summary
The primary responsibility is to supervise the day-to-day nursing activities of the facility in accordance with current federal, state, and local standards, guidelines, and regulations.
Essential duties include assisting the Director of Nursing in directing nursing activities, participating in policy development, ensuring compliance with procedures, and managing personnel.
The role requires providing direct nursing care as necessary, monitoring medication passes, and participating in staff development and safety programs.
